理装置。 A relatively large-capacity main catalyst is arranged in the exhaust passage of an internal combustion engine, and on the upstream side of this main catalyst,
In an exhaust treatment device for an internal combustion engine, which is provided with an auxiliary catalyst of relatively small capacity for raising the exhaust gas temperature mainly through catalytic action, the auxiliary catalyst has the following characteristics:
An exhaust gas treatment device for an internal combustion engine, characterized in that it has a large number of mesh-like fine passages, and a communication hole having a relatively large passage cross-sectional area is formed through a part of the passages.
